How to Get to Tortolì

Plane

Although Tortolì doesn’t have its own airport, you can fly to Cagliari Elmas Airport (CAG), which is located 57 miles from Tortolì. The shortest flight to Tortolì from the United Kingdom departs from London and takes around 2h 40m.

Train

Trenitalia is the only carrier operating train routes to Tortolì.

Car

Another option to get to Tortolì is to pick up a car hire from Olbia, which is about 69 miles from Tortolì. You’ll find branches of Rental4Leisure and Target Italy, among others, in Olbia.
